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team arrives on the scene, equipped with advanced moisture-reading technology to pinpoint the source of the damage and develop a customized drying plan.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and preventing further damage.
Step 2: Containment and Preparation
Our technicians work to contain the affected area, preventing further damage and ensuring a safe working environment. We also prepare the area for drying, removing any hazardous materials and setting up equipment as needed.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Using specialized equipment, such as desiccants and dehumidifiers, our technicians work to quickly and efficiently remove excess moisture from your home.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Once the drying process is complete, our team works to sanitize and clean the affected area, removing any remaining moisture and preventing mold growth. This step ensures that your home is safe and healthy to occupy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our technicians conduct a final inspection to ensure that the restoration is complete and your home is restored to its pre-storm condition. We also perform any necessary touch-ups to ensure a seamless finish.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ost in Park City, UT
The cost of storm damage restoration can vary widely, dep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the local conditions in Park City, UT.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are intended to provide a general idea of what to expect. Keep in mind that every situation is unique,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imate.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$100-$500 | Severity and extent of damage, size of affected area |
| Containment and Preparation |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000-$5,000 | Severity and extent of moisture damage, size of affected area |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$500-$2,000 | Severity and extent of mold growth, size of affected area |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100-$500 | Severity and extent of remaining damage, size of affected area |
